Product Details – Flight Path Golf Tees

  • Material: High-performance polycarbonate
  • Length: 3.25 inches
  • Style: Pack of 8 or 16
  • Color: White
  • Durability: Impact-resistant
  • Friction Reduction: Low friction design for smooth ball flight
  • Ball Spin: Decreases spin for longer drives
  • USGA Approved: Legal for tournament play

Material and Durability

Made from polycarbonate, Flight Path Golf Tees stand out for their impressive durability. Unlike traditional wooden or cheap plastic tees, these are built to withstand powerful swings without breaking after a few hits. Golfers have noted that a single tee can last several rounds, making the investment worthwhile.

Friction and Spin Reduction

Flight Path’s claim to fame is its low-friction design, which is intended to reduce side spin. By decreasing the amount of contact between the ball and the tee, golfers can expect straighter shots with more distance. This feature makes them ideal for both amateurs looking to improve their game and experienced players who need consistent performance.

The reduction in spin allows for a more controlled flight path, giving you the confidence to aim for long, straight drives. This tee will not only help you with distance but also with accuracy, which is essential when navigating tough courses.

Stability and Ease of Use

The design is robust, but some golfers find the initial setup a little tricky. Because of the unique shape, getting the ball to stay securely on the tee might require a bit of practice. However, once you get the hang of it, the tee offers a solid and stable platform, reducing the likelihood of mishits.

USGA Approval

If you’re concerned about tournament legality, Flight Path Golf Tees are USGA approved. This means you can confidently use them in official games without worrying about disqualification. For golfers who frequently play in competitions, this is a significant advantage.

Drawbacks to Consider

While these tees bring a lot to the table, there are a couple of things worth noting. First, their higher price point may deter budget-conscious golfers. At around $20 for a pack, they are more expensive than standard wooden tees. Second, as mentioned earlier, placing the ball on the tee might take a little getting used to. For those who prefer a quick setup, this could be frustrating initially.
